Picnic Idea Blueberry Grilled Cheese Ingredients

For the Sandwich

  • Sourdough or White Bread – Provides structure and a crispy exterior; any soft sandwich bread works, too.
  • Fresh or Frozen Blueberries – Adds sweetness and fruity flavor; try raspberries or strawberries as tasty substitutes.
  • Sugar – Enhances the sweetness of the blueberries; adjust based on natural ripeness.
  • Cream Cheese or Brie – Brings creaminess and richness; other mild cheeses like mozzarella can be used.
  • Shredded Mozzarella or Fontina Cheese – Offers the perfect melt and stretch; avoid sharp cheeses to maintain harmony.
  • Butter – Ensures a golden, crispy toast every time.
  • Flaky Sea Salt – Elevates the flavors with a sweet-salty contrast, making this Blueberry Grilled Cheese irresistible!

Step‑by‑Step Instructions for picnic idea Blueberry Grilled Cheese

Step 1: Prepare the Blueberry Mixture
In a small saucepan, combine fresh or frozen blueberries with sugar over medium heat. Cook for 5–7 minutes, gently mashing the blueberries with a fork as they soften. Continue until the mixture thickens and becomes jammy; you’ll know it’s ready when it coats the back of a spoon. Once thickened, remove from heat and allow to cool slightly.

Step 2: Assemble the Sandwiches
Spread a generous layer of cream cheese or brie on one side of each slice of your chosen bread for the Blueberry Grilled Cheese. On two selected slices, layer a sprinkle of shredded mozzarella or fontina cheese over the cream cheese. Then, evenly spoon the cooled blueberry mixture on top of the cheese, ensuring an even distribution to capture all that delicious flavor.

Step 3: Complete the Sandwiches
With the blueberry mixture in place, gently place the remaining bread slices on top, cream cheese side down, to form two sandwiches. Press down lightly to ensure the ingredients stick together. This step is crucial for a cohesive grilled cheese that won’t fall apart while cooking, allowing the sweet and savory flavors to meld beautifully.

Step 4: Cook the Sandwiches
Preheat a skillet over medium-low heat, ensuring the temperature is just right to avoid burning the bread. Butter the outer sides of each assembled sandwich generously, allowing the butter to melt onto the hot skillet. Place the sandwiches in the skillet and cook for 3–4 minutes per side, until golden brown and crispy. You’ll know they’re done when the cheese starts to ooze out.

Step 5: Finishing Touches
Once cooked, remove the Blueberry Grilled Cheese from the skillet and let them rest for 1–2 minutes. This resting period allows the cheese to set slightly, enhancing flavors and texture. After resting, slice each sandwich diagonally for a beautiful presentation, and sprinkle with a pinch of flaky sea salt to elevate the sweet and savory contrast.

Step 6: Serve and Enjoy
Now that your picnic idea Blueberry Grilled Cheese is ready, plate them up while they’re warm. Consider pairing with a light arugula salad or a comforting bowl of tomato soup. Each bite will delight with a crunchy exterior giving way to a gooey, sweet-salty interior, making for an unforgettable culinary experience!

Variations & Substitutions for Blueberry Grilled Cheese

Want to make your Blueberry Grilled Cheese even more exciting? Let your creativity soar with these delightful twists and substitutions!

  • Berry Swap: Try Raspberries or Strawberries for a different fruity flavor; reduce sugar depending on sweetness.

  • Vegan Option: Use Dairy-Free Cheese and Vegan Butter to create a luscious melt that’s plant-based and delicious. Your friends will never know it’s vegan!

  • Herb Infusion: Add a sprinkle of Fresh Basil or Mint to the blueberry mix for an aromatic twist that elevates the dish to new heights.

  • Nutty Crunch: Incorporate Chopped Nuts like walnuts or almonds inside the sandwich for a delightful crunch, adding a satisfying texture.

  • Savory Kick: Spice things up by adding Crushed Red Pepper Flakes to the blueberry mixture for a warm heat that contrasts beautifully with the sweetness.

  • Cheese Medley: Experiment with a mix of Gouda, Brie, or Fontina for a gooey flavor explosion—just avoid strong, sharp cheeses that might overwhelm the dish.

  • Sweet Drizzle: Consider drizzling Honey or Balsamic Glaze over the finished sandwich for an indulgent touch that enhances the sweet-salty balance.

Make Ahead Options

Preparing the Blueberry Grilled Cheese ahead of time is a game changer for busy weeknights or picnic planning! You can make the blueberry mixture up to 3 days in advance; simply store it in an airtight container in the refrigerator. When you’re ready to enjoy this delicious twist on a classic comfort food, spread the cream cheese and assemble the sandwiches about 30 minutes before cooking to ensure freshness. To maintain the perfect crispy texture, butter the bread just before grilling. Cook the sandwiches as instructed, and you’ll achieve that gooey, sweet-salty delight, just like freshly made! This strategy ensures you spend less time in the kitchen and more time savoring your delightful creation.

Storage Tips for Blueberry Grilled Cheese

Room Temperature: Enjoy your Blueberry Grilled Cheese while warm; it’s best eaten immediately. If left out, consume within 2 hours to ensure freshness.

Fridge: Store leftover sandwiches in an airtight container for up to 3 days. To reheat, place in a skillet over low heat to maintain crispiness while warming the cheese.

Freezer: You can freeze assembled sandwiches for up to 1 month. Wrap tightly in plastic wrap and foil. To enjoy, thaw overnight in the fridge and reheat in a skillet for optimal texture.

Reheating: For best results, reheat in a skillet on medium-low until the cheese melts and the bread is crispy, ensuring the flavors of your Blueberry Grilled Cheese are fully revived.

What should I do if the cheese is not melting properly while cooking?
If you notice that the cheese isn’t melting well, the heat might be too high. Try lowering the temperature to medium-low, and cover the skillet with a lid – this helps trap heat around the sandwiches, allowing the cheese to melt more effectively without burning the bread. It’s an essential step for a perfect, gooey center!

Picnic Idea Blueberry Grilled Cheese for Sweet & Savory Bliss

Experience the divine sweetness of fresh blueberries blended with gooey cheese in this picnic idea Blueberry Grilled Cheese.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 10 minutes
Resting Time 2 minutes
Total Time 27 minutes
Servings: 2 sandwiches
Course: Snacks
Cuisine: American
Calories: 350

Ingredients
  

For the Sandwich
  • 2 slices Sourdough or White Bread Any soft sandwich bread works too.
  • 1 cup Fresh or Frozen Blueberries Try raspberries or strawberries as substitutes.
  • 2 tablespoons Sugar Adjust based on natural ripeness.
  • 4 ounces Cream Cheese or Brie Other mild cheeses like mozzarella can be used.
  • 1 cup Shredded Mozzarella or Fontina Cheese Avoid sharp cheeses.
  • 2 tablespoons Butter For toasting.
  • 1 pinch Flaky Sea Salt Elevates the sweet-salty contrast.

Equipment

  • Skillet
  • Saucepan
  • spatula

Method
 

Step-by-Step Instructions for picnic idea Blueberry Grilled Cheese
  1. In a small saucepan, combine fresh or frozen blueberries with sugar over medium heat. Cook for 5–7 minutes, gently mashing the blueberries with a fork as they soften.
  2. Spread a generous layer of cream cheese or brie on one side of each slice of your chosen bread for the Blueberry Grilled Cheese.
  3. On two selected slices, layer a sprinkle of shredded mozzarella or fontina cheese over the cream cheese. Evenly spoon the cooled blueberry mixture on top of the cheese.
  4. Gently place the remaining bread slices on top, cream cheese side down, to form two sandwiches. Press down lightly to ensure the ingredients stick together.
  5. Preheat a skillet over medium-low heat. Butter the outer sides of each assembled sandwich generously. Place the sandwiches in the skillet and cook for 3–4 minutes per side until golden brown and crispy.
  6. Once cooked, remove the Blueberry Grilled Cheese from the skillet and let them rest for 1–2 minutes. Slice each sandwich diagonally and sprinkle with a pinch of flaky sea salt.
  7. Plate the sandwiches while they're warm and consider pairing with a light arugula salad or a comforting bowl of tomato soup.
